Fame And Service: FRSC Induct Celebrity Special Marshals

Silver Jubilee celebrations really got the Federal Road Safety Commission (FRSC) waxing creative. As part of the agency’s activities to usher in a new phase of life-saving operations, it organized a public lecture and induction of celebrity special marshals last Friday.

Seyi Law, Oge Okoye, Chico Ejiro, Teju Babyface and Jaywon among others, are the new ensigns of the FRSC.

The event occurred at the  A2W Center, Ikeja Lagos, on Friday March 8, 2013. With a huge turnout of celebrities, media personnel, and FRSC top guns, Managing Director of THIS DAY newspaper got the event running with a lecture delivery. Sini Titsi Kwabe, FRSC National Coordinator of Special Marshals, gave the next specch.

Keynote speech duties was was executed by the Zonal Commander, Ademola Lawal, and FRSC Corp Marshal Osita Chidoka gave the new inductees, urging them to be exemplars in a world ridden with traffic anarchy.

The swearing-in ceremony was carried out to the delight of all present. On conclusion, ace broadcaster gave a speech of appreciation and expressed the willingness to save lives as a key feature in their decision to join the agency.

‘On behalf of my fellow inductees, we would like to say a very big thank you for accepting  us to become part of a family that is determined to reduce accidents on our roads and save lives’.

Training for the newly inducted celebrity special marshals is slated for March 21, 2013.
